B: April 3, 1885 in Toronto, Ontario
D: December 21, 1983 in Woodland Hills, California
Allan Dwan once said “If you hold your head up above the mob, they try to knock it off. If you stay down, you last forever.” The following list is a small sampling of the more than 400 movies he directed which includes 300 silent short movies and over a hundred feature films. He’s believed to have contributed as a writer, actor, producer, and director to as many as 1500 movies. Learn more about Allan Dwan. |
